Understanding SMA vs EMA: Essential Tools for Trend Trading

Discover the variations between Easy and Exponential Shifting Averages, key indicators for merchants. Find out how these instruments will help establish market traits and enhance buying and selling methods.





Within the realm of technical evaluation, shifting averages stand as elementary instruments, offering merchants with insights into market traits. The Bitfinex Chart Decoder Sequence delves into these important indicators, specializing in the Easy Shifting Common (SMA) and Exponential Shifting Common (EMA), essential for pattern buying and selling.

What Are Shifting Averages?

Shifting averages are designed to simplify worth information by smoothing out fluctuations over a specified time interval. This simplification helps merchants establish the market’s route, potential entry and exit factors, and ensure indicators from different indicators. The 2 main kinds of shifting averages are the Easy Shifting Common (SMA) and the Exponential Shifting Common (EMA), every serving distinct functions.

Easy Shifting Common (SMA): The Secure Indicator

The SMA calculates the common worth over a set variety of durations, giving equal weight to every worth level. This technique is good for assessing long-term market traits, because it filters out short-term volatility. Generally, swing merchants use the 50-day and 200-day SMAs for this objective. Nevertheless, SMAs might lag in fast-moving markets, probably lacking early pattern indicators.

Exponential Shifting Common (EMA): The Responsive Software

Contrasting the SMA, the EMA locations extra emphasis on latest costs, making it extra delicate to present market circumstances. This responsiveness makes it a favourite amongst day merchants and scalpers. EMAs are sometimes utilized in crossover methods, the place short-term EMAs crossing long-term EMAs can sign market entry or exit factors. Nevertheless, they will additionally produce false indicators in uneven markets.

SMA vs EMA: Selecting the Proper Software

The selection between SMA and EMA relies on a dealer’s particular objectives and buying and selling type. Many skilled merchants use each, using SMAs for pattern affirmation and EMAs for figuring out entry factors. For example, a 200-day SMA would possibly affirm a long-term pattern, whereas a 20-day EMA might point out a possible entry alternative.
